I realise this may be completely out of place on this board, but I wanted to share the quiet hope and joy that inundates Spain after the permanent ceasefire called by the Basque terrorist group ETA. This may just signal the end of a form of mindless terror that has smothered my country for as long as I can remember.

There's still a long way to go for us in dealing with our internal situation, but there seems to be a brighter hope now. Goodness knows we need it, when there are so many other forms of terror still left to grapple with all over the world.
